Transaction 74436e0da69f8a30019804a838d6d4c786e6906684516590291378a4002926fc
1 Input
1 Output
-
74436e0da69f8a30019804a838d6d4c786e6906684516590291378a4002926fc:0
- value
- 36250
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 488ed1942412ca62425b5a755b458287a98a7e72 OP_EQUAL
- address
- 38Jffa3KbjNZ87LUFqt8Qft6LHAWqi8vf3